Problem

Existing connectors for induction cooking appliances lack safety features that ensure power supply cutoff during insertion or extraction, posing a risk of electric arcing and potential breakdown of the insulated gate bipolar transistor (IGBT) associated with the electronic driving circuit.

Innovation Solution

A connector design with five male terminals, including two for power, two for temperature sensors, and one ground connection, where the ground terminal disconnects last during extraction, ensuring safe and reliable insertion and extraction by automatically cutting off power supply when the induction tray is removed.

Solution Approach 1:

The connector employs asymmetric terminal lengths where the ground terminal extends further than the power terminals. This asymmetric design ensures that during extraction, the ground connection disconnects last, preventing electric arcing and enhancing safety without requiring complex control systems.

AI summary

A movable cooking appliance comprises a structure which is adapted to be placed on a kitchen worktop appliance or inside a cooking oven appliance and includes a heating element and releasable connector assembly for making electrical connection with power supply connectors. The heating element is an induction heating element and an electronic driving unit is mounted on the appliance. The releasable connector assembly comprising a plug connector having a plurality of terminals designed in order to provide a disconnection signal to the electronic unit before the power supply connectors are fully extracted.
